/** * @fileoverview Tests for report types */ import { ReportType, ReportStatus } from '../types/report-types.js'; describe('Report Types', () => { describe('ReportType enum', () => { it('should have correct compliance-specific report types', () => { expect(ReportType.OWASP_TOP_10).toBe('OWASP_TOP_10'); expect(ReportType.SANS_TOP_25).toBe('SANS_TOP_25'); expect(ReportType.MISRA_C).toBe('MISRA_C'); }); it('should have correct general report types', () => { expect(ReportType.CODE_COVERAGE).toBe('CODE_COVERAGE'); expect(ReportType.CODE_HEALTH_TREND).toBe('CODE_HEALTH_TREND'); expect(ReportType.ISSUE_DISTRIBUTION).toBe('ISSUE_DISTRIBUTION'); expect(ReportType.ISSUES_PREVENTED).toBe('ISSUES_PREVENTED'); expect(ReportType.ISSUES_AUTOFIXED).toBe('ISSUES_AUTOFIXED'); }); it('should have all expected report types', () => { const allReportTypes = Object.values(ReportType); expect(allReportTypes).toHaveLength(8); expect(allReportTypes).toContain('OWASP_TOP_10'); expect(allReportTypes).toContain('SANS_TOP_25'); expect(allReportTypes).toContain('MISRA_C'); expect(allReportTypes).toContain('CODE_COVERAGE'); expect(allReportTypes).toContain('CODE_HEALTH_TREND'); expect(allReportTypes).toContain('ISSUE_DISTRIBUTION'); expect(allReportTypes).toContain('ISSUES_PREVENTED'); expect(allReportTypes).toContain('ISSUES_AUTOFIXED'); }); it('should be usable in type guards', () => { const isValidReportType = (value: string): value is ReportType => { return Object.values(ReportType).includes(value as ReportType); }; expect(isValidReportType('OWASP_TOP_10')).toBe(true); expect(isValidReportType('CODE_COVERAGE')).toBe(true); expect(isValidReportType('INVALID_TYPE')).toBe(false); }); }); describe('ReportStatus enum', () => { it('should have correct status values', () => { expect(ReportStatus.PASSING).toBe('PASSING'); expect(ReportStatus.FAILING).toBe('FAILING'); expect(ReportStatus.NOOP).toBe('NOOP'); }); it('should have all expected statuses', () => { const allStatuses = Object.values(ReportStatus); expect(allStatuses).toHaveLength(3); expect(allStatuses).toContain('PASSING'); expect(allStatuses).toContain('FAILING'); expect(allStatuses).toContain('NOOP'); }); it('should be usable in switch statements', () => { const getStatusMessage = (status: ReportStatus): string => { switch (status) { case ReportStatus.PASSING: return 'All checks passed'; case ReportStatus.FAILING: return 'Some checks failed'; case ReportStatus.NOOP: return 'Not applicable'; default: return 'Unknown status'; } }; expect(getStatusMessage(ReportStatus.PASSING)).toBe('All checks passed'); expect(getStatusMessage(ReportStatus.FAILING)).toBe('Some checks failed'); expect(getStatusMessage(ReportStatus.NOOP)).toBe('Not applicable'); }); }); describe('Integration tests', () => { it('should be able to use both enums together', () => { interface ComplianceReport { type: ReportType; status: ReportStatus; } const report: ComplianceReport = { type: ReportType.OWASP_TOP_10, status: ReportStatus.PASSING, }; expect(report.type).toBe('OWASP_TOP_10'); expect(report.status).toBe('PASSING'); }); it('should support enum iteration for building UI options', () => { // Simulate building dropdown options from enums const reportTypeOptions = Object.entries(ReportType).map(([key, value]) => ({ label: key.replace(/_/g, ' '), value, })); expect(reportTypeOptions.length).toBe(8); expect(reportTypeOptions[0]).toEqual({ label: 'OWASP TOP 10', value: 'OWASP_TOP_10', }); }); }); });
